How We Build Custom CRM for Gold Coast
Discovery for Gold Coast businesses begins with the people who manage the firm's highest-value client relationships and the service staff who interact with clients most frequently. For a luxury boutique on Oak Street, that means observing how an experienced sales associate navigates a client visit: what she recalls from memory, what she wishes she had written down, and what client knowledge she has shared informally with colleagues versus kept to herself. For a wealth management practice, it means interviewing the advisor who manages the firm's most complex household relationships about the data she wishes she had at every client touchpoint.
From discovery, we design data models that fit the specific relationship structures of Gold Coast's client-facing businesses. A luxury retail CRM centers on individual client profiles with full purchase history, style and preference data, communication logs, and the alert systems that notify the right associate when relevant new inventory arrives. A wealth management CRM centers on household objects with multi-generational contacts, account relationships, referral network tracking, and the communication history and scheduled outreach workflows that define a well-managed advisory relationship.
We integrate with the operational systems already in use. For luxury retailers, that means integration with POS systems to pull transaction data automatically. For medical practices, it means integration with practice management systems to surface appointment history and referral data within the CRM interface. For wealth managers, it means integration with portfolio management and financial planning software. The custom CRM becomes the relationship intelligence layer that sits above the operational systems, not a replacement for them.
Industries We Serve in Gold Coast
Luxury boutiques and specialty retailers on Oak Street and the surrounding 900 North Michigan Shops corridor need client knowledge management that captures individual purchase history by brand, category, and occasion, size and style profiles, the communication cadence each client prefers, and the alert workflows that convert new inventory arrivals into personalized client outreach rather than generic marketing email blasts.
Private wealth management firms on Dearborn Street and State Street need client relationship management organized around households, multi-generational contacts, referral networks of accountants and estate attorneys, and the complete communication history across portfolio reviews, estate planning conversations, and life events. The compliance overlay required for registered investment advisors adds audit trail and documentation requirements that generic CRMs cannot satisfy without substantial customization.
Medical and dental specialists serving the Gold Coast patient base from offices on Rush Street and Division Street need patient relationship management that surfaces referral sources, tracks communication history across multiple visits, identifies patients whose annual care milestones are approaching, and coordinates the specialist-to-specialist referral relationships that fill a high-end practice's schedule. HIPAA-compliant architecture is designed in from the start.
Interior designers and architecture firms serving Gold Coast residential clients on Astor Street and the surrounding historic district need project relationship management that tracks each client's aesthetic preferences across projects, their budget history and renovation cadence, the trade vendor relationships that serve each client's home, and the referral chains that connect satisfied clients to new prospects.
High-end restaurants and private clubs serving Gold Coast regulars build guest relationships around visit history, table and dietary preferences, anniversary and celebration tracking, and the personal details that transform a reservation into a genuinely personalized experience. The tools that support this are not a restaurant's POS system. They are a guest relationship management layer built specifically for the business of hospitality.
Beauty, spa, and wellness businesses on the Gold Coast serve clients with complex service histories, product preferences, and the appointment patterns that signal when outreach is warranted. A custom CRM for a Gold Coast spa captures the full client relationship across services, products, and the stylist or therapist relationships that make a specific provider a client's reason for returning.
What to Expect Working With Us
1. Discovery. Two to three weeks of structured workshops and observation sessions with your relationship managers, service staff, and client-facing team. We document every workflow, data requirement, and integration dependency before architecture begins. Confidentiality agreements are standard for Gold Coast engagements involving client financial data.
2. Architecture and design. We design the data model, interface approach, integration architecture, and phased delivery plan specific to your business's relationship structure. For Gold Coast wealth management and medical practices, architecture includes privacy, security, and compliance requirements from the start.
3. Implementation. We build in phases. Your team has a working system within eight to ten weeks, with subsequent phases adding advanced reporting, integrations, and workflow automation without disrupting the core system already in use.
4. Training and iteration. Post-launch adoption monitoring, structured training for every client-facing team member, and optional maintenance retainers for feature additions and integration updates as your client base evolves.
